VENIMUS ADORARE EUM
WHY DID KINGS LEAVE YOUR PALACE?
WHY DID KINGS PURSUE THE MIGRANT STAR?
WHY DID KINGS KNEEL BEFORE A KID?
AS SOMEONE ASKED THEM, THEY RESPONDED:


WE HAVE COME TO ADORE HIM,
WE HAVE COME TO ADORE HIM, THE EMMANUEL

WHY DID THE SHEPHERDS LEAVE THEIR HERDS AT NIGHT?
WHY DID THE MOUNTAINS HEAR THE SONG OF ANGELS?
WHY DID THEY KNEEL BEFORE A KID AN PRAY,
TO THESE QUESTIONS, THEY RESPONDED,


OH EMMANUEL - GOD IS WITH US.
O EMMANUEL

SO WE'RE GATHERED HERE, TO WORSHIP THEE
WE'RE CHILDREN ANOINTED, HIS PROPHETS ARE WE
WE ARE GATHERED HERE TO ENCOUNTER HIM
IN THE BREAD, IN THE WINE, AND IN YOU, IN ME,
LET'S SING IT:


WE HAVE COME TO ADORE HIM, EMMANUEL, GOD IS WITH US. WE HAVE COME TO ADORE HIM, EMMANUEL.
